CHIANG MAI DOMINATE ONCE AGAIN

The third  National Youth Cricket Championship which was held in Chanthaburi  from 23rd to 28th March 2012 was a triumph for the Cricket Association of Thailand as nine boys teams and ten  girls teams competed for  honours, and in particular for Chiang Mai who won both boys and girls tournaments and remained unbeaten in all their matches.

YOUTH CRICKET IN THAILAND – FULL SPEED AHEAD

The Cricket Association of Thailand is currently hosting the third National Youth Championship in Chanthaburi, as cricket is developing fast across the provinces of Thailand.

Nine boys teams and 10 girls teams are competing in the biggest tournament yet to be staged in Thailand with a total of 44 matches spread over six days from the 23rd to 28th March 2012.

The first National Youth Championship was held in Bangkok in November 2009 with six boys teams and four girls teams playing a total of 15 matches in a four-day tournament, while the second edition of the event was held in Bangkok in January 2011 with nine boys teams and six girls teams playing a total of 23 matches in four days.

NATIONAL YOUTH CRICKET CHAMPIONSHIP 2012

Cricket continues to establish a strong foundation in Thailand with growing number of tournaments, seminars and courses every year.  CAT has set new boundaries and goals for every province by continuously introducing and promoting cricket to new regions.  With close to 5000 boys and girls already playing cricket, these new endless boundaries are giving birth to new players all over Thailand.  CAT’s team continues to broaden cricket throughout Thailand without any self interest and political motivation.  Having set the things in motion with the highly successfully 2nd National Youth Cricket Championship last year, this year an addition of 6 teams, a total of 21 teams will be competing

INTER UNIVERSITY 2012 SPARKS A REVOLUTION

“Sport isnot an expression of some biological human need, it is a social institution.” Michael Messner.“Sport is not an expression of some biological human need, it is a social institution.” Michael Messner
Cricket Association of Thailand recently took another landmark initiative of spreading the game of cricket to the locals with the first ever Inter University Cricket Tournament in Thailand, held at the Terd Thai Ground (TCG) in Lat Krabang, Bangkok.
What was seen during those 6 days of competitive cricket was a mixture of experience and exuberance coming together to form a potent mix, which bodes very well for cricket in Thailand.  Quite a few young and upcoming crickets impressed the club scouts who were on hand to witness the game and a lot of new local young talent was identified during the course of the matches.
